Gehirnwäsche: Systementwicklung - Seite 2

 

Sehen Sie sich das obige Bild an: Der Kurs bewegt sich auf die Aufwärtskanallinie zu, und der Auftrag sollte jetzt geschlossen werden.

Ungeachtet dessen.

Die Order kann also geschlossen werden bei:

- S/L, der sich um T/S bewegt;

- im Gewinn durch T/P;

- bei Unterstützungs- oder Widerstandslinien eines anderen Indikators (siehe Anhang).

Dateien:
 

Ok, ich habe die Version geändert

und

ich mache CalcBackBars nur 1 ?

 

Ja, nur 1.

Und ich habe den Fehler gefunden. Siehe die Bilder. Das Signal wurde bereits von Verkauf auf Kauf geändert, aber der EA hat den Verkauf nicht geschlossen und den Kauf nicht geöffnet.

Der Auftrag sollte geschlossen werden, wenn die Signale plötzlich geändert wurden.

Dateien:
brainbug.gif  10 kb
brainbug1.gif  44 kb
 

Sorry, aber ich habe ein Problem verstanden

Wenn sich der Kurs den Hoch- oder Tiefstkursen nähert

Kaufauftrag schließen

wenn der Kurs die untere Linie CLOSE überschreitet?

Verkauf-Order schließen

wenn CLOSE die High-Linien kreuzt?

Können Sie das mit einem Bild erklären?

Danke

 

Ich spreche nur von einem Ausstieg mit Gewinn. Ihr S/L bewegt sich in die richtige Richtung.

Ich möchte eine weitere Bedingung zum Schließen hinzufügen. Siehe die Bilder.

Wenn der Preis die Widerstandslinie (hohe Linie) überschritten hat, sollte der Kauf (wenn es ein Kaufauftrag war) geschlossen werden.

Bei einem Verkaufsauftrag und wenn der Preis die untere Linie (Unterstützungslinie) überschritten hat, wird der Auftrag geschlossen. In beiden Fällen wird es im Gewinn sein.

Aber der Preis kreuzt nicht die Hoch- und Tiefstkurse, weil diese Linien dynamisch sind. Die Hoch/Tief-Linien bewegen sich zusammen mit dem Kurs. Der Preis nähert sich also dem Hoch/Tief, oder besser gesagt, er kommt näher.

Siehe Bilder.

Aber verbessern Sie die Version 1 (Bruno hat die Version 2 getestet und sie war nicht gut, aber die Version 1 ist ok).

Dateien:
brain11.gif  11 kb
brain12.gif  22 kb
 

Kaufauftrag schließen

wenn sich der Kurs der oberen Linie nähert.

Verkaufsauftrag schließen

wenn sich der Kurs der Low-Linie nähert.

Der Kurs wird niemals das Hoch oder das Tief überschreiten. Er nähert sich nur. Nahe oder gleich, sagen wir mal.

Und ich habe den Fehler gefunden. Siehe Bild. Das Signal wurde von Verkauf auf Kauf geändert, aber der EA hat die Verkaufsorder nicht geschlossen und die Kauforder nicht geöffnet.

Eine andere Bedingung zum Schließen der Order: das Signal wurde geändert (auf dem 1 bar).

Siehe die Erklärung. Der EA behielt den Verkauf für jpy bei und das Signal wurde bereits geändert (siehe Bild).

Dateien:
brain13.gif  10 kb
brainst.htm  11 kb
 

Ok, danke

 

Ok habe die neue Version fertiggestellt

bitte prüfen Danke

-PARAMETER-

calcCloseDOTBars = 0 alle Dots schließen Order

calcCloseDOTBars = 1 alle 100% Dots close Order

useClose.Trade.Rules = True newdigital's Close Regel

EA lässt nur Indikator laufen

"Price Channel"

"PriceChannel_Stop_v1"

bitte lesen Sie alle Beiträge von Brainwashing

viel Spass und helft mir mit der Idee zu kodieren

Siehe Download-Bereich

 
Alex.Piech.FinGeR:

-PARAMETER-

calcCloseDOTBars = 0 alle Dots schließen Auftrag

calcCloseDOTBars = 1 alle 100% Dots schließen Auftrag

Alex bitte können Sie sagen, was ist calcCloseDOTBars = 0 oder 1?

Erklären Sie ich wirklich nicht verstehen.

 

sorry mein englisch ist nicht gut

calcCloseDOTBars =0 // jeden Tick berechnen

calcCloseDOTBars = 1 // nur komplette BAR berechnen

und

CalBackBar = 1 // berechnet nur komplette BARs

CalBackBar = 0 // Berechnung bei jedem Tick

verstehen ?

calcCloseDOTBars Idee umbenennen ?

CalBackBar umbenennen Idee ?